Course overviewStudy a professional forestry course at our National School of Forestry in the iconic Lake District National Park – a UNESCO World Heritage Site just minutes from our Ambleside campus. Gain the skills to start a career in a sector crucial for biodiversity, society and the economy, with a pathway into the National School of Forestry.
On this course you will...- Develop hands-on skills with our 150 hours of work experience.- Get accredited by the Institute of Chartered Foresters.- Use the latest forest management technology, such as remote sensing and drones during your studies, to enhance your employability.- Benefits from our more than 50 years' experience educating and training professional and award-winning foresters.- Boost your employability through our excellent links with the Royal Forestry Society, Institute of Chartered Foresters (ICF) and many other forestry organisations.
What you will learnThis course is ideally located to explore and practice the management of forests, with the National School of Forestry based on our inspirational Ambleside campus in the heart of the Lake District. You’ll receive a thorough introduction to the forestry profession combined with a work-experience option to back up your theoretical knowledge. Our four week work experience offers you a fantastic chance to gain more hands-on forestry work in a real-life context, whilst on campus you’ll have access on your doorstep to study in woodlands managed for timber, conservation and social benefits.The skills you develop will see you go on to a rewarding career in forestry both in the UK and potentially internationally. You’ll have the qualifications necessary to progress to the top-up BSc (Hons) Forestry degree should you wish to take your studies further. You will study the sustainable management of forests and woodlands for commercial, social benefits and conservation management.
Year one- Introduction to Managing Trees, Woods and Forests- Measuring Trees and Forests- Silviculture- Woodland Ecology- Wood Utilisation & Processing- Forestry Fundamentals- Practical Forest Skills
Year two- Work Experience- Geographic Information Systems- Managing Forest Operations- Forest Policy and Governance- Forest Health and Protection- People and Forests- Forest Design and Planning
